The deployed processes should be able to run without the need to redeploy them. You should really only have to redeploy if:
- If you want to make use of the new features made available in 4.5
- You want to address an issue with the code in the K2 wizards.
As with any upgrades, do ensure that you test this in a Development or Staging environment prior to Production in order to catch any issues should they occur, but in your case since its only dev, making backups of the databases should be sufficient.
